Basque-speaking smart speaker based on Mycroft AI Short Name: Smart euSpeaker Name: Basque-speaking smart speaker based on Mycroft AI Coordinator: Igor Leturia, Elhuyar Fundazioa Project Runtime: August 2020 – July 2021 Funded by: European Language Grid The speech-driven virtual assistant devices known as smart speakers, such as Amazon Echo and Google Home, are being increasingly used, but these commercial products come in just over a handful of languages: not all official languages of the EU, let alone minority languages, are present in them. The Smart euSpeaker project aims to develop an open source smart speaker that works in Basque language, making use of Elhuyar’s Basque speech synthesis and recognition technology. It will be open source, as it will be based on the also open source Mycroft voice assistant (https://mycroft.ai/).
